To attach an embedded images to email, you should add an attachment to … WebNov 2, 2024 · There are two basic approaches to attaching images to email messages: enclosing and embedding. Everything is straightforward with enclosing: you add it as a separate file which doesn’t affect the HTML structure. In this case, your recipient will get the attached image as it is, unchanged and uncompressed. fastxchange: your universal sourcing solution
